// The request body of the `SearchProfiles` call.
message SearchProfilesRequest {
  // Required. The resource name of the tenant to search within.
  //
  // The format is "projects/{project_id}/tenants/{tenant_id}". For example,
  // "projects/foo/tenants/bar".
  string parent = 1 [
    (google.api.field_behavior) = REQUIRED,
    (google.api.resource_reference) = {
      type: "jobs.googleapis.com/Tenant"
    }
  ];

  // Required. The meta information collected about the profile search user. This is used
  // to improve the search quality of the service. These values are provided by
  // users, and must be precise and consistent.
  RequestMetadata request_metadata = 2 [(google.api.field_behavior) = REQUIRED];

  // Search query to execute. See [ProfileQuery][google.cloud.talent.v4beta1.ProfileQuery] for more details.
  ProfileQuery profile_query = 3;

  // A limit on the number of profiles returned in the search results.
  // A value above the default value 10 can increase search response time.
  //
  // The maximum value allowed is 100. Otherwise an error is thrown.
  int32 page_size = 4;

  // The pageToken, similar to offset enables users of the API to paginate
  // through the search results. To retrieve the first page of results, set the
  // pageToken to empty. The search response includes a
  // [nextPageToken][google.cloud.talent.v4beta1.SearchProfilesResponse.next_page_token] field that can be
  // used to populate the pageToken field for the next page of results. Using
  // pageToken instead of offset increases the performance of the API,
  // especially compared to larger offset values.
  string page_token = 5;

  // An integer that specifies the current offset (that is, starting result) in
  // search results. This field is only considered if [page_token][google.cloud.talent.v4beta1.SearchProfilesRequest.page_token] is unset.
  //
  // The maximum allowed value is 5000. Otherwise an error is thrown.
  //
  // For example, 0 means to search from the first profile, and 10 means to
  // search from the 11th profile. This can be used for pagination, for example
  // pageSize = 10 and offset = 10 means to search from the second page.
  int32 offset = 6;

  // This flag controls the spell-check feature. If `false`, the
  // service attempts to correct a misspelled query.
  //
  // For example, "enginee" is corrected to "engineer".
  bool disable_spell_check = 7;

  // The criteria that determines how search results are sorted.
  // Defaults is "relevance desc" if no value is specified.
  //
  // Supported options are:
  //
  // * "relevance desc": By descending relevance, as determined by the API
  //    algorithms.
  // * "update_date desc": Sort by [Profile.update_time][google.cloud.talent.v4beta1.Profile.update_time] in descending order
  //   (recently updated profiles first).
  // * "create_date desc": Sort by [Profile.create_time][google.cloud.talent.v4beta1.Profile.create_time] in descending order
  //   (recently created profiles first).
  // * "first_name": Sort by [PersonName.PersonStructuredName.given_name][google.cloud.talent.v4beta1.PersonName.PersonStructuredName.given_name] in
  //   ascending order.
  // * "first_name desc": Sort by [PersonName.PersonStructuredName.given_name][google.cloud.talent.v4beta1.PersonName.PersonStructuredName.given_name]
  //   in descending order.
  // * "last_name": Sort by [PersonName.PersonStructuredName.family_name][google.cloud.talent.v4beta1.PersonName.PersonStructuredName.family_name] in
  //   ascending order.
  // * "last_name desc": Sort by [PersonName.PersonStructuredName.family_name][google.cloud.talent.v4beta1.PersonName.PersonStructuredName.family_name]
  //   in ascending order.
  string order_by = 8;

  // When sort by field is based on alphabetical order, sort values case
  // sensitively (based on ASCII) when the value is set to true. Default value
  // is case in-sensitive sort (false).
  bool case_sensitive_sort = 9;

  // A list of expressions specifies histogram requests against matching
  // profiles for [SearchProfilesRequest][google.cloud.talent.v4beta1.SearchProfilesRequest].
  //
  // The expression syntax looks like a function definition with parameters.
  //
  // Function syntax: function_name(histogram_facet[, list of buckets])
  //
  // Data types:
  //
  // * Histogram facet: facet names with format [a-zA-Z][a-zA-Z0-9_]+.
  // * String: string like "any string with backslash escape for quote(\")."
  // * Number: whole number and floating point number like 10, -1 and -0.01.
  // * List: list of elements with comma(,) separator surrounded by square
  // brackets. For example, [1, 2, 3] and ["one", "two", "three"].
  //
  // Built-in constants:
  //
  // * MIN (minimum number similar to java Double.MIN_VALUE)
  // * MAX (maximum number similar to java Double.MAX_VALUE)
  //
  // Built-in functions:
  //
  // * bucket(start, end[, label])
  // Bucket build-in function creates a bucket with range of [start, end). Note
  // that the end is exclusive.
  // For example, bucket(1, MAX, "positive number") or bucket(1, 10).
  //
  // Histogram Facets:
  //
  // * admin1: Admin1 is a global placeholder for referring to state, province,
  // or the particular term a country uses to define the geographic structure
  // below the country level. Examples include states codes such as "CA", "IL",
  // "NY", and provinces, such as "BC".
  // * locality: Locality is a global placeholder for referring to city, town,
  // or the particular term a country uses to define the geographic structure
  // below the admin1 level. Examples include city names such as
  // "Mountain View" and "New York".
  // * extended_locality: Extended locality is concatenated version of admin1
  // and locality with comma separator. For example, "Mountain View, CA" and
  // "New York, NY".
  // * postal_code: Postal code of profile which follows locale code.
  // * country: Country code (ISO-3166-1 alpha-2 code) of profile, such as US,
  //  JP, GB.
  // * job_title: Normalized job titles specified in EmploymentHistory.
  // * company_name: Normalized company name of profiles to match on.
  // * institution: The school name. For example, "MIT",
  // "University of California, Berkeley"
  // * degree: Highest education degree in ISCED code. Each value in degree
  // covers a specific level of education, without any expansion to upper nor
  // lower levels of education degree.
  // * experience_in_months: experience in months. 0 means 0 month to 1 month
  // (exclusive).
  // * application_date: The application date specifies application start dates.
  // See [ApplicationDateFilter][google.cloud.talent.v4beta1.ApplicationDateFilter] for more details.
  // * application_outcome_notes: The application outcome reason specifies the
  // reasons behind the outcome of the job application.
  // See [ApplicationOutcomeNotesFilter][google.cloud.talent.v4beta1.ApplicationOutcomeNotesFilter] for more details.
  // * application_job_title: The application job title specifies the job
  // applied for in the application.
  // See [ApplicationJobFilter][google.cloud.talent.v4beta1.ApplicationJobFilter] for more details.
  // * hirable_status: Hirable status specifies the profile's hirable status.
  // * string_custom_attribute: String custom attributes. Values can be accessed
  // via square bracket notation like string_custom_attribute["key1"].
  // * numeric_custom_attribute: Numeric custom attributes. Values can be
  // accessed via square bracket notation like numeric_custom_attribute["key1"].
  //
  // Example expressions:
  //
  // * count(admin1)
  // * count(experience_in_months, [bucket(0, 12, "1 year"),
  // bucket(12, 36, "1-3 years"), bucket(36, MAX, "3+ years")])
  // * count(string_custom_attribute["assigned_recruiter"])
  // * count(numeric_custom_attribute["favorite_number"],
  // [bucket(MIN, 0, "negative"), bucket(0, MAX, "non-negative")])
  repeated HistogramQuery histogram_queries = 10;

  // An id that uniquely identifies the result set of a
  // [SearchProfiles][google.cloud.talent.v4beta1.ProfileService.SearchProfiles] call. The id should be
  // retrieved from the
  // [SearchProfilesResponse][google.cloud.talent.v4beta1.SearchProfilesResponse] message returned from a previous
  // invocation of [SearchProfiles][google.cloud.talent.v4beta1.ProfileService.SearchProfiles].
  //
  // A result set is an ordered list of search results.
  //
  // If this field is not set, a new result set is computed based on the
  // [profile_query][google.cloud.talent.v4beta1.SearchProfilesRequest.profile_query].  A new [result_set_id][google.cloud.talent.v4beta1.SearchProfilesRequest.result_set_id] is returned as a handle to
  // access this result set.
  //
  // If this field is set, the service will ignore the resource and
  // [profile_query][google.cloud.talent.v4beta1.SearchProfilesRequest.profile_query] values, and simply retrieve a page of results from the
  // corresponding result set.  In this case, one and only one of [page_token][google.cloud.talent.v4beta1.SearchProfilesRequest.page_token]
  // or [offset][google.cloud.talent.v4beta1.SearchProfilesRequest.offset] must be set.
  //
  // A typical use case is to invoke [SearchProfilesRequest][google.cloud.talent.v4beta1.SearchProfilesRequest] without this
  // field, then use the resulting [result_set_id][google.cloud.talent.v4beta1.SearchProfilesRequest.result_set_id] in
  // [SearchProfilesResponse][google.cloud.talent.v4beta1.SearchProfilesResponse] to page through the results.
  string result_set_id = 12;

  // This flag is used to indicate whether the service will attempt to
  // understand synonyms and terms related to the search query or treat the
  // query "as is" when it generates a set of results. By default this flag is
  // set to false, thus allowing expanded results to also be returned. For
  // example a search for "software engineer" might also return candidates who
  // have experience in jobs similar to software engineer positions. By setting
  // this flag to true, the service will only attempt to deliver candidates has
  // software engineer in his/her global fields by treating "software engineer"
  // as a keyword.
  //
  // It is recommended to provide a feature in the UI (such as a checkbox) to
  // allow recruiters to set this flag to true if they intend to search for
  // longer boolean strings.
  bool strict_keywords_search = 13;
}
